Output 076e53f364601c18ddfea1e6570f558b9d0d91b04243473d9be4f4c2a5d5ea07:0

value
21001664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e06860e32da33bc43395925f8e638b26e799579 OP_EQUAL
address
32yBCW111BmYnaLPcnDxmdxNuEpWtX1u66
transaction
076e53f364601c18ddfea1e6570f558b9d0d91b04243473d9be4f4c2a5d5ea07
confirmations
385774
spent
true